This article is published by Ryze AI (get-ryze.ai), an autonomous AI platform for Google Ads and Meta Ads management. Ryze AI automates bid optimization, budget allocation, and performance reporting without requiring manual campaign management. It is used by 2,000+ marketers across 23 countries managing over $500M in ad spend. This guide explains how to troubleshoot and fix Meta Ads catalog sync errors in 2026, covering error types, root causes, 8-step diagnostic framework, and proven solutions for e-commerce catalog synchronization issues.

E-COMMERCE

Meta Ads Catalog Sync Errors Troubleshooting Fix 2026 — Complete Resolution Guide

Meta ads catalog sync errors troubleshooting fix 2026 requires systematic diagnosis of API connectivity, authentication failures, and data validation issues. This guide covers 8 diagnostic steps, 12 common error types, and proven solutions that resolve 95% of catalog synchronization problems within 24 hours.

Ira Bodnar··Updated ·18 min read

What are Meta ads catalog sync errors troubleshooting fix 2026?

Meta ads catalog sync errors troubleshooting fix 2026 addresses the critical connectivity issues between e-commerce platforms and Meta Business Manager that prevent product catalogs from updating automatically. These errors manifest as missing products, outdated pricing, failed inventory updates, and authentication failures that break dynamic product ads, Advantage+ catalog campaigns, and retargeting workflows. With e-commerce spending projected to reach $8.1 trillion globally in 2026, catalog sync disruptions can cost retailers $500-$5,000 daily in lost conversions.

The complexity stems from Meta's evolving API requirements, stricter data validation rules introduced in Q1 2026, and the intricate handoff between your product feed, middleware platforms (Shopify, WooCommerce, BigCommerce), and Meta's Marketing API. A typical sync failure cascades through multiple systems: your inventory management software exports data to your e-commerce platform, which formats it into a feed that gets processed by Meta's catalog ingestion system, validated against commerce policies, and distributed to ad serving infrastructure.

According to Meta's Q1 2026 Commerce Platform Report, 73% of catalog sync errors are resolved within 4 hours using systematic diagnostics, while 22% require authentication re-establishment, and 5% indicate deeper integration architecture problems. The most expensive failures occur during high-traffic periods (Black Friday, seasonal sales) when fresh inventory data is critical for dynamic ads performance. For comprehensive automation approaches that bypass many sync issues entirely, see Top AI Tools for Meta Ads Management in 2026.

1,000+ Marketers Use Ryze

State Farm
Luca Faloni
Pepperfry
Jenni AI
Slim Chickens
Superpower

Automating hundreds of agencies

Speedy
Human
Motif
s360
Directly
Caleyx
G2★★★★★4.9/5
TrustpilotTrustpilot stars

What are the 12 most common Meta catalog sync errors?

Understanding error patterns is crucial for efficient troubleshooting. Meta's Business Manager displays generic messages like "sync failed" or "authentication error," but the underlying causes fall into predictable categories. Each error type has specific diagnostic steps and targeted fixes that resolve 85% of cases within the first attempt.

Error TypeFrequencyTypical CauseResolution Time
OAuth Token Expired31%60-day token rotation5 minutes
Feed Format Validation23%Required fields missing15 minutes
Product Policy Violations18%Prohibited content2-24 hours
API Rate Limiting12%Too many requests10 minutes
Business Manager Permissions8%User role restrictions30 minutes
Server Connectivity Issues8%Network/firewall blocksVariable

OAuth token expiration accounts for nearly one-third of all sync failures. Meta rotates access tokens every 60 days as a security measure. Most e-commerce platforms handle renewal automatically, but misconfigurations or permission changes can break this cycle. The fix involves re-authenticating the connection through your platform's Meta integration settings.

Feed format validation errors spike during platform migrations or when merchants modify product data structures. Meta requires 13 core fields (id, title, description, availability, condition, price, link, image_link, brand, google_product_category, shipping, tax, and mpn or gtin). Missing even one field triggers a validation failure that blocks the entire sync.

Product policy violations are increasingly common as Meta tightens commerce policies. Alcohol, supplements, weapons, adult content, and cryptocurrency-related products trigger automatic rejections. Even borderline items like protein powders or CBD products can cause sync failures if descriptions contain flagged keywords. The resolution requires either content modification or category adjustments.

Tools like Ryze AI automate catalog sync monitoring and error resolution — detecting failures within minutes, automatically re-authenticating connections, and fixing data validation issues before they impact ad performance. Ryze AI clients experience 94% fewer sync-related ad disruptions.

How to diagnose Meta catalog sync errors: 8-step framework

Effective troubleshooting follows a systematic elimination process. Random fixes waste time and can worsen connectivity issues. This framework identifies root causes in order of probability, starting with the most common failures and progressing to complex integration problems. Resolution rate: 91% within 24 hours following this sequence.

Step 01

Check Sync Status Dashboard

Navigate to Meta Business Manager → Catalog Manager → Data Sources → Your Feed. Check the "Last Sync" timestamp and error indicators. A sync older than 24 hours suggests an active problem. Red error badges indicate failed uploads, while yellow warnings show partial sync issues. Note the specific error codes (e.g., "Error 100," "Error 613") for targeted troubleshooting. Screenshot the error details for support documentation if needed.

Step 02

Verify Authentication Status

In your e-commerce platform (Shopify, WooCommerce, BigCommerce), locate the Meta/Facebook integration settings. Look for "Connected" or "Authorized" status indicators. If status shows "Disconnected," "Expired," or displays error messages, the OAuth token needs renewal. Test the connection using the platform's "Test Connection" or "Refresh Token" function. Failed tests indicate authentication problems requiring re-authorization.

Step 03

Validate Feed Structure

Download your current product feed (CSV or XML) and verify required fields exist with proper data types. Use Meta's Feed Quality Tool or manually check for: unique product IDs, non-empty titles/descriptions, valid image URLs, proper pricing format ($XX.XX), availability status (in stock/out of stock), and category mappings. Empty cells, special characters, or malformed URLs trigger validation failures.

Step 04

Review Recent Platform Changes

Check for recent updates to your e-commerce platform, installed apps/plugins, theme modifications, or bulk product edits. Platform updates often change API endpoints or data structures that break existing integrations. Review activity logs for the 7 days preceding the sync failure. Plugin conflicts are especially common with Shopify stores using multiple marketing apps that compete for API resources.

Step 05

Test API Rate Limits

Monitor your API call volume in Business Manager → Settings → API. Meta enforces rate limits based on your ad spend and business verification status. Stores pushing frequent inventory updates or running multiple marketing platforms can exceed limits. Check for "Rate Limited" errors in logs. If approaching limits, implement batch processing or reduce sync frequency from every 15 minutes to hourly.

Step 06

Analyze Product Policy Compliance

Review rejected products for policy violations. Common triggers include: alcohol/tobacco keywords, supplement claims ("weight loss," "muscle building"), weapons/safety equipment, adult content references, and cryptocurrency terms. Use Meta's Commerce Policy Guide to identify problematic content. Products with age restrictions, prescription requirements, or regulatory compliance issues often face automatic rejection.

Step 07

Check Server Connectivity

Verify your server can reach Meta's API endpoints (graph.facebook.com). Test using command line tools or online connectivity checkers. Corporate firewalls, IP restrictions, or hosting provider limitations can block outbound API calls. Check SSL certificate validity and DNS resolution. If using a CDN or proxy service, ensure it allows connections to Facebook's IP ranges.

Step 08

Document and Escalate

If steps 1-7 don't resolve the issue, compile diagnostic data for support escalation: error codes, timestamps, affected product counts, recent platform changes, and testing results. Use your platform's support channels (Shopify Partners, WooCommerce support) or Meta Business Support. Include specific technical details rather than generic descriptions like "sync not working." Complex integration issues may require developer intervention.

Ryze AI — Autonomous Marketing

Eliminate catalog sync errors with automated monitoring

  • Automates Google, Meta + 5 more platforms
  • Handles your SEO end to end
  • Upgrades your website to convert better

2,000+

Marketers

$500M+

Ad spend

23

Countries

How to fix Meta catalog authentication errors permanently?

Authentication errors represent 31% of all catalog sync failures and typically require complete re-authorization rather than token refresh. The underlying cause usually involves permission changes, Business Manager restructuring, or app/user removals that invalidate existing OAuth grants. Fixing authentication requires understanding Meta's permission hierarchy and ensuring your integration has sustained access.

Step 1: Complete Re-Authentication Process. Navigate to your platform's Meta integration settings and click "Disconnect" or "Remove Integration." Wait 60 seconds for the token revocation to propagate through Meta's systems. Click "Connect to Facebook" or "Add Integration" to start fresh authentication. Grant all requested permissions, even if they seem excessive. Partial permission grants cause intermittent sync failures that are difficult to diagnose.

Step 2: Verify Business Manager Access. Confirm your Facebook account has Admin or Editor access to both the Business Manager and the specific catalog. Navigate to Business Settings → People → Select Your Account → Assets. Verify "Catalogs" shows "Admin" access for your target catalog. If not, request access from your Business Manager admin. Employee or Partner roles often lack sufficient catalog permissions for successful sync.

Step 3: Review App Permissions. In Facebook Settings → Apps and Websites → Business Integrations, locate your e-commerce platform's app (e.g., "Shopify," "WooCommerce"). Verify it has active permissions for: "catalog_management," "ads_management," "pages_read_engagement," and "business_management." Remove any expired or "Limited" permissions and re-grant full access. Consider AI-powered solutions like Claude Skills for Meta Ads for automated permission monitoring.

Step 4: Enable Long-Term Tokens. Many platforms request 60-day tokens by default, requiring frequent re-authentication. Look for "Extended Access" or "Long-Term Token" options in your integration settings. Shopify Plus and WooCommerce Premium support permanent tokens that don't expire. For standard accounts, set up automated token renewal notifications 7 days before expiration to prevent surprise disconnections.

What are the proven data validation fixes for catalog sync errors?

Data validation errors block 23% of catalog syncs and require systematic field-by-field correction. Meta's validation engine became stricter in Q1 2026, rejecting feeds with minor formatting inconsistencies that previously passed through. The most effective approach involves bulk validation tools, automated data cleaning, and template standardization to prevent recurring issues.

Required Field Optimization: Meta mandates 13 core fields, but many platforms export 20+ optional fields that can trigger validation conflicts. Create a minimal feed template containing only: id, title, description, availability, condition, price, link, image_link, brand, google_product_category, shipping, tax, and either mpn or gtin. Remove custom fields, internal SKU references, and promotional text that don't map to Meta's schema.

Image URL Validation: Broken image links cause 15% of validation failures. Implement automated image checking that tests each URL for: HTTPS protocol (HTTP images are rejected), proper file formats (JPG, PNG, WebP), minimum dimensions (500x500 pixels), maximum file size (8MB), and accessibility (no login required). Use CDN services like Cloudflare or AWS CloudFront to ensure consistent image availability across global regions.

Price and Currency Formatting: Meta requires specific price formatting that varies by currency. Use the format "XX.XX USD" rather than "$XX.XX" or "XX,XX €." Remove thousand separators, currency symbols, and promotional text like "Starting at" or "As low as." For variable pricing products, use the lowest available price to prevent rejection. Multi-currency stores should specify the currency code for each product rather than relying on account-level defaults.

Category Mapping Accuracy: Google Product Category mapping failures increased 40% in 2026 due to new subcategory requirements. Use Meta's official category taxonomy rather than your internal categories. Popular mappings include: "Apparel & Accessories > Clothing" for fashion, "Electronics > Computers & Tablets" for tech, "Health & Beauty > Personal Care" for cosmetics. Avoid generic categories like "Other" which trigger manual review delays. For category optimization workflows, explore How to Use Claude for Meta Ads automation.

How to resolve Meta API connectivity issues?

API connectivity problems affect 8% of catalog syncs but often indicate deeper infrastructure issues that can impact multiple marketing platforms simultaneously. These failures manifest as timeout errors, connection refused messages, or partial data transfers that corrupt the sync process. Resolution requires both immediate fixes and long-term infrastructure hardening.

Firewall and IP Whitelist Configuration: Corporate networks and hosting providers often block Facebook's API endpoints by default. Whitelist the following IP ranges: graph.facebook.com (157.240.0.0/16), edge-mqtt.facebook.com (31.13.64.0/18), and api.facebook.com (185.60.216.0/22). Contact your hosting provider or IT administrator to configure firewall rules that allow outbound HTTPS traffic on port 443 to these destinations. Some providers require explicit approval for social media API access.

SSL Certificate and Protocol Verification: Meta requires TLS 1.2 or higher for all API connections. Outdated servers or misconfigured SSL certificates cause connection failures. Test your server's SSL configuration using tools like SSL Labs Server Test. Ensure your hosting environment supports modern cipher suites and has valid certificates for your domain. Self-signed certificates or expired SSL will trigger "handshake failure" errors.

Rate Limit Management: Implement exponential backoff for API retry logic. When rate limits trigger (HTTP 429 responses), wait progressively longer between retry attempts: 1 second, 2 seconds, 4 seconds, 8 seconds, then abort. Batch multiple product updates into single API calls rather than individual requests. Most platforms support bulk operations that reduce total API call volume by 60-80%. Monitor your rate limit status in Business Manager → Settings → API.

CDN and Proxy Considerations: Content delivery networks and proxy services can interfere with API authentication. Disable proxy settings for Meta API endpoints if using services like Cloudflare Proxy or AWS CloudFront. Some CDNs cache API responses inappropriately, causing stale data issues. Configure your CDN to bypass caching for any URLs containing "facebook.com" or "graph.facebook.com." For advanced API management strategies, consider automated MCP solutions that handle connectivity logic.

What prevention strategies eliminate recurring sync errors?

Prevention costs 90% less than reactive troubleshooting. Implementing monitoring, validation, and backup systems reduces emergency fixes and maintains consistent ad performance. The most successful e-commerce businesses treat catalog sync as critical infrastructure requiring the same attention as payment processing or inventory management.

Automated Monitoring Systems: Set up alerts for sync failures, authentication expirations, and data validation warnings. Use tools like UptimeRobot or Pingdom to monitor your product feed URLs for availability and response time. Configure email notifications when sync status changes from "Active" to "Error" in Business Manager. Monitor API quota usage to prevent rate limit surprises during high-traffic periods.

Scheduled Maintenance Windows: Plan major platform updates, theme changes, and plugin installations during low-traffic periods. Test all changes in staging environments before production deployment. Create rollback plans for integration modifications that might break catalog connectivity. Maintain a schedule of token expiration dates and renew authentication 7 days before expiration rather than waiting for failures.

Data Quality Governance: Implement product data standards that prevent validation failures: standardized image dimensions (1200x1200px), consistent category mapping, required field completion rules, and price format validation. Train team members responsible for product uploads on Meta's requirements. Use data validation tools in your e-commerce platform to catch formatting errors before they reach Meta's systems.

Backup Integration Methods: Maintain secondary sync methods for critical sales periods. Many platforms support both API-based sync and manual feed uploads. During Black Friday or product launches, enable both methods temporarily to ensure catalog availability if primary sync fails. Consider third-party catalog management platforms like Feedonomics or DataFeedWatch as backup options for mission-critical campaigns.

Sarah K.

Sarah K.

Paid Media Manager

E-commerce Agency

★★★★★

We went from catalog sync failures every week to zero disruptions in four months. Ryze AI caught authentication issues before they broke our dynamic product ads.”

0

Sync failures

4 months

Zero downtime

94%

Fewer disruptions

Frequently asked questions

Q: How often do Meta catalog sync errors occur?

According to Meta's Q1 2026 report, 73% of e-commerce businesses experience at least one catalog sync error monthly. OAuth token expiration causes 31% of failures, while feed validation issues account for 23%. Most errors resolve within 4 hours using systematic troubleshooting.

Q: What causes "Authentication Failed" errors in Meta catalog sync?

Authentication failures typically result from expired OAuth tokens (60-day rotation), insufficient Business Manager permissions, or app authorization removals. Fix by re-authenticating the integration, verifying Admin access to the catalog, and ensuring your Facebook account has proper platform permissions.

Q: How can I prevent recurring Meta ads catalog sync errors?

Implement automated monitoring for sync status, set up token renewal alerts 7 days before expiration, validate product data before upload, and maintain backup sync methods during critical sales periods. Regular maintenance prevents 85% of recurring sync failures.

Q: Which product data fields are required for successful Meta catalog sync?

Meta requires 13 core fields: id, title, description, availability, condition, price, link, image_link, brand, google_product_category, shipping, tax, and either mpn or gtin. Missing any field triggers validation failure that blocks the entire sync process.

Q: How long does it take to fix Meta catalog sync errors?

OAuth token renewal takes 5 minutes, feed validation fixes require 15 minutes, policy violation reviews take 2-24 hours, and complex integration issues may need developer intervention. Following the 8-step diagnostic framework resolves 91% of errors within 24 hours.

Q: Can AI tools help prevent Meta catalog sync errors?

Yes. AI-powered platforms like Ryze AI monitor sync status 24/7, automatically re-authenticate expired connections, validate product data before upload, and alert teams to potential issues. Clients experience 94% fewer sync-related ad disruptions compared to manual management.

Ryze AI — Autonomous Marketing

Stop catalog sync errors before they break your ads

  • Automates Google, Meta + 5 more platforms
  • Handles your SEO end to end
  • Upgrades your website to convert better

2,000+

Marketers

$500M+

Ad spend

23

Countries

Live results across
2,000+ clients

Paid Ads

Avg. client
ROAS
0x
Revenue
driven
$0M

SEO

Organic
visits driven
0M
Keywords
on page 1
48k+

Websites

Conversion
rate lift
+0%
Time
on site
+0%
Last updated: Apr 19, 2026
All systems ok

Let AI
Run Your Ads

Autonomous agents that optimize your ads, SEO, and landing pages — around the clock.

Claude AIConnect Claude with
Google & Meta Ads in 1 click
>